President Joe Biden on Friday signed a bill to avert a nationwide rail strike, forcing the adoption of a labor agreement brokered by his administration in September that thousands of union workers opposed.

Workers were set to strike on Dec. 9, something that could have cost the economy around $2 billion per day once it began, according to a report from the Association of American Railroads. The House this week also passed an extra measure to give workers seven paid sick days, but it failed in the Senate on Thursday, with most Republicans and Democrat Joe Manchin of West Virginia voting against the addition.
The compromise labor agreement was brokered by the Biden administration in September, and it was favored by the railroads and a majority of the unions — but was opposed by four of the 12 unions, which in total represent roughly 115,000 employees at large freight railroads.
